Central Asian Shepherd vs Kangal Shepherd Dog: full comparison

TraitCentral Asian ShepherdKangal Shepherd Dog
SizeGiantGiant
Energy levelMediumMedium
TrainabilityVery LowLow
FriendlinessLowLow
Good with childrenLowMedium
Grooming needsMediumMedium
SheddingHighHigh
BarkingMediumMedium
ProtectivenessVery HighVery High
AdaptabilityVery LowLow
Typical lifespan12 years12 years
HypoallergenicNoNo

Temperament, training and family life

The Central Asian Shepherd has a stubborn streak that calls for patience and know-how, barks a fair amount, usually for a reason and can live with children but needs careful, supervised introductions. The Kangal Shepherd Dog needs a bit of persistence but comes along with consistency, barks a fair amount, usually for a reason and is generally good with children when socialized and supervised. On guarding instinct, Central Asian Shepherd is a strong natural guardian with a powerful protective instinct, whereas Kangal Shepherd Dog is a strong natural guardian with a powerful protective instinct.
